The native girl gave Orv a surprised smile. "You have some herb lore, do you?"
"You could say that," the little spirit replied with an answering smile. "I'm a
land healer. When we're done with the monsters, I will heal the poisoned land here
before I go home."
"I'll pass the word. Maybe some farmers will come and say which fields need
help."
The group of adventurers moved on down the flower-lined road, toward the forest
with the dark and foggy spot in the middle.
Vengeance said, "This chaos gate, is it a big visible stone gate, like when we
fought in Gateway Arena?"
Orv shook his, or her, or its head. "It is a wound in Ghea, which has festered
through the volcanic flow Sheila Greywand used to try and seal it. The world beyond
that breach is as poisonous to our world as our world is to that world." Shaking its
head, it spat to the side, as though tasting something vile. "The breach is under the
polluted water and I don't recommend going through to the other side. It's likely
that the enemy will be on this side, maybe in the water as the poison comforts them.
In case you have to enter the water, I'll make you a salve to protect your bodies and
your equipment, but that won't last more than an hour."
Tortured Trout frowned as he strode down the road. "Sounds like it would be best
to lure them out of the water. What can we do to really piss them off?"
Orv gasped a surprised laugh, sounding as innocent as a child -- a child with
mischief on its mind. "I don't know them well, but I'd guess these invaders are
fanatics who take themselves very seriously. If they think you are making fun of
them..."
Marduk nodded. "So, we pants them."
Teetotaler shook his head. "Nnn... ah. We're talking about making them come out
of the water to fight us. How would that work?"
"I could make an illusion," Trout suggested, rubbing his bearded chin.
Teddy Brewster shrugged. "When we see them, we should simply charge!"
"We hide in the trees," said Vengeance. "Trout makes an illusion of a farmer
pantsing one of the poison weasels. They get offended and come ashore to deal with
it. THEN we charge. Hmm. There are six of us, and seven of them. Orv, do you
fight?"
The little spirit shook its head, then said, "Well... it depends. You can see
that I'm not as big and strong as all of you."
"But you are of Ghea," said Tortured Trout. "Can you poison those things with a
touch?"
"Oh. Yes, I suppose so. But if I am slain, I can't heal the land."
"We won't include you in the fighting line, then. Or Trout, either. You guys
are support. The five of us can take those evil weasels."
They had been walking rapidly as they made their plans. Now, they were in the
forest, which looked sick. It was mostly oak and maple and sycamore trees, which
should have had green leaves on this warm island, but all the leaves were shriveled
and black, and curled up on the ground. The tree skeletons looked twisted, as though
they were in pain. The group of fighters walked up a small rise in the land, and
looked down upon a swamp, pools of bubbling yellowish water that stank of sulfur and
rot.
Vengeance looked at Orv. "Can you tell where they are?"
The nature spirit stretched out its arm, pointing at a particularly large pool.
"Four of them. The other three might still be in their own world."
Teddy Brewster shifted his feet, hefted his sword, and snorted. "Let's just
charge."
DUELMASTER'S COLUMN
Notes from the arena champ.
They say be the change that you wish to see, so I'm doing just that! I'm writing a
Duelmaster's column in hopes that it will inspire others to take a more active role in
Seam.
I took this throne through the death of another, so I want to start by saying sorry to
Thirsty Thugs for killing Sau Sage. It is not my intent to kill an opponent, but we
are not fighting with blunted weapons. The goal is to fight, live, and improve with
each match. The truth is my start in this arena was very rough. Wins are hard to come
by in such a small environment, especially if you have an experience disadvantage or a
style disadvantage, sometimes both.
The important part is to survive in such conditions. I have done that so far, but who
knows what tomorrow will bring? I will be avoiding The Ogre Troll. I have no desire to
fight an immortal. By default, that means I will also be avoiding Sunrise Victory. Who
will I fight? I don't know, but the goal remains the same--survive.
-- Duelmistress
Freya Bearmaw
SPY REPORT
Seam greeted me gently this turn, my sweets. The wind was calm, the stands were quiet
in an unfamiliar way, and Turn 276 unfolded with more skill than spite. There were
hard blows, yes, but also moments with smiles if you were paying attention. Let's take
a look at all the action.
At the center of it all stands Freya Bearmaw, still holding the Duelmaster's title.
She defended it swiftly against Sunrise Victory, making it clear that her grip on the
throne is firm. There was no malice in the win, just confidence and precision.
This turn's warmest cheers belonged to Psyde. His victory over The Ogre Troll was
exciting and well-earned, and it brought him the title of This Week's Favorite. You
could see the pride in his team afterward, and it is always nice to see Seam
celebrate.
As teams go, Thirsty Thugs had the biggest climb this turn, gaining momentum and
confidence. Darque Knights followed closely behind, steady and consistent as ever. The
Warlords had a tougher outing, slipping back a bit, though even strong teams have
quiet weeks in the arena.
I noticed the Warlords were the most avoided team this turn. Whether that comes from
respect, uncertainty, or simple caution, only the matchmakers truly know. Still,
avoidance says something in Seam, and it was Darque Knights that avoided the most.
There is always a shadow alongside the victories. Many of our regular teams were
missing this cycle. Seam moves quickly, but names linger longer than dust. All in
all, Turn 276 felt calm, but eerily quiet. Strength held steady, new promises stirred,
and Seam reminded us that even in a place built for combat, there is room for growth
and pride.
Hugs and Curses,
-- Sidara Brightbell
